Low Anxiety Will Kill You

At 47:14 · chapter starts 46:48

Most people think of negative thinking as a habit or personality trait. Dr. Amen's recently published study on negativity bias shows it's also a neurological event: chronic negative thinking decreases activity in the prefrontal cortex, impairing motivation, focus, and mood. But the solution isn't naive optimism. A Stanford study that began in 1921 and tracked 1,548 ten-year-old children across their lifetimes found something counterintuitive: the carefree, low-anxiety 'don't worry, be happy' people died earliest from accidents and preventable illnesses. The people who lived longest were consistently conscientious — those who showed up when they said they would, reliably and repeatedly. This, Amen explains, is a frontal lobe signature. High frontal lobe function drives the disciplined habits — good sleep, proper nutrition, avoiding substances — that in turn protect the frontal lobes. The chapter also tackles the neuroscience of New Year resolutions: relapse happens predictably when you're sleep-deprived, blood sugar is low, hormonal cycles are at their worst, or ANTs (automatic negative thoughts) are flooding in. The real goal isn't a six-pack — it's better frontal lobe function.
